DataFrames.jl: Flexible and Fast Tabular Data in Julia

Milan Bouchet-Valat, Bogumił Kamiński

Main Article Content

Abstract

DataFrames.jl is a package written for and in the Julia language offering flexible and efficient handling of tabular data sets in memory. Thanks to Julia's unique strengths, it provides an appealing set of features: Rich support for standard data processing tasks and excellent flexibility and efficiency for more advanced and non-standard operations. We present the fundamental design of the package and how it compares with implementations of data frames in other languages, its main features, performance, and possible extensions. We conclude with a practical illustration of typical data processing operations.

Article Details

Article Sidebar